Full job description

As a salaried GP, you will provide high-qualitymedical care to our patients, ensuring that each consultation is thorough andeffective. You will work within a supportive environment, supported

by a friendly team of clinicians, administrativestaff, and management. This role involves working

to ensure excellent patient care and service,contributing to the development and improvement

of practice systems and participating in trainingand development activities.

Key Responsibilities

Provide general medical services to registeredpatients, ensuring a high standard of care and professionalism.Consult with patients regarding their health concerns, providing appropriatemedical advice, diagnostics, and treatment. Prescribe medication as necessaryand ensure the safe management

of prescribing within the practice. Contribute tothe development of practice policies, guidelines,

and quality improvement initiatives. Participate inregular multi-disciplinary team meetings to

discusspatient care and practice matters.Conduct home visits when necessary and in line with practice protocols.Maintain accurate and

up-to-date patient records. We already use EMISclinical system and have implemented

Electronic Prescribing. Support practice staff andparticipate in the development of clinical skills

and knowledge.Participate in Continuing Professional Development (CPD) and other educationalactivities as

required by the GMC and NHS Wales. Maintainup-to-date knowledge of clinical guidelines, NHS Wales policies, and otherrelevant developments.

Attend and contribute to practice meetings,including clinical governance, team briefings, and

other meetings. Promote and adhere to NHS Walesvalues, ensuring that patient care remains

central to all activities.


Person Specification


Qualifications

* Fully qualified GP eligible to work in General Practice in the NHS
* Clear DBS report
* GMC registration
* Experience working in general practice, primary care environment
* Experience with IT system EMIS


Experience

* Excellent verbal and written communication skills
* Ability to work with integrated care pathways, protocols and patient specific directives
* Experience of working in primary care


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
